## Runbook: Notification Fan-out Backpressure

When the Brindlecast fan-out queue depth exceeds the amber threshold, consumers shed low-priority notification classes first and log each dropped batch. Before approving a release during backpressure, confirm the shed-log table shows no high-priority drops in the last hour. To run that verification query against the delivery ledger, connect to the ledger database using the string below.

primary connection of tajeg-tajop = postgresql://julax_svc:DI@db-e7f3.kelvidyn.corp:5432/rusdor

## Break-Glass: Shelfwing Catalogue Import

If the nightly catalogue import wedges mid-batch and Marda's off-shift, you can unlock the Shelfwing admin vault yourself. Heads up: this bypasses the normal approval flow, so ping the release channel after. Open the vault console, pick "emergency import unlock," and enter the recovery passphrase shown below.

recovery phrase for tagug-yagug: lamox-gilax-keleth-gilath

### Step 4: Enable Monthly Partitions

Before your plugin writes to the Lanternfall events store, confirm that the target table has been converted to range partitioning by month. Run `lanternctl partition verify events_raw` and check that a partition exists for the current and next month; writes to an uncovered range will be rejected, not queued. The verification tool needs direct database access, supplied via the connection string below.

primary connection of yagep-kahip = redis://giliel_svc:zYiKsLL2PLpfPL@db-348f.xolmarsys.corp:5432/fenwyn

## Connection Pooling — Quarrelwood API

The Quarrelwood API shares a single pool per worker process against the Lintmere Postgres cluster. Pool exhaustion is the most common cause of the 503s you'll see paged for; check active connections before restarting anything. Never raise the pool size without checking the cluster's max_connections budget, since the batch workers draw from the same headroom. The values below are what production runs today, and staging mirrors them exactly.

config for kafof-bawef:
holath:
  log_level: debug
  metrics_host: metrics.holath.qorvelsys.internal
  pin: 2191
  pool_size: 32